Anki is a digital flashcard application widely used for studying and memorization purposes. It employs spaced repetition, a technique that aids long-term information retention by spacing out the intervals between reviewing material based on the user's familiarity with it. Anki allows users to create decks of flashcards containing questions and answers, images, audio, and even videos to enhance learning. The platform supports various languages and is known for its flexibility and customization options, making it a popular tool among students, language learners, and professionals seeking to expand their knowledge base efficiently.
